a) NOTE I ORDERED BOTH OF THESE INDIVIDUALLY. They do not come as a set, but are the same MFG and equal quality ( one is a 3 string version, the other is a 4 string) b) Arrive well packaged and undamaged. c) These look and feel like gold plated solid brass, even though they are not. d) The 3 string retainer is for 4 string basses and the 4 string retainer is for 5 string basses ( you usually don't retain the low E string). D) Before you make screw marks, loosen up your strings and place these where the strings are least stressed at the top and bottom of the retainers, then mark the holes and remove retainer before drilling pilot holes. These are solid and anchor the strings well. e) The only potential issue I can see is the edges are somewhat sharp and potential might cut into the string, but I doubt that will be an issue. You won't be able to file them down without removing the finish so I don't recommend that. If your hardware is gold colored, I recommend these!

This is substantial/heavy; important. I added it to a Fender short-scale P/J Mustang bass, which has a typical amount of real estate on the headstock and it wasn't tough, once I'd removed the stock tree.I like the thoughtful layout of the string slots, and the width is on-target for a Jazz-width nut. One thing that concerns me is the juncture of the trees and strings. There is "more of a corner" there than I'm used to with string trees, and I'm nervous that it will simply wind up cutting the string as it is played over time. If that occurs, I will update. Otherwise, nice string tree for good price.

Good for locking strings in place and retaining tension, also retains the life of the nut by focusing the tension in-line. Looks great and easy to install. Make sure to loosen the strings and mark the screw holes and double check before drilling. Works very well and priced perfectly. The four string retainer fits best on a headstock that has two left and right tuners.
